R38Q (p.Arg38Gln) variant of IFT172 (Q9UG01)
R38Q (p.Arg38Gln) in IFT172 (Q9UG01) is a missense change. Clinical records from ClinVar, EBI, and UniProt describe it as uncertain significance in the context of Short-rib thoracic dysplasia 10 with or without polydactyly; Retinitis pigmentos. The available variant effect predictions contribute to a CATVariant prioritization score of 0.51 / 1. The record also includes population frequency data, published literature, and structural context.
